On power and dignity in defeat.
Winning is pretty easy. It takes effort to get there, but once we’ve done it, most people can act with grace. It reveals more about a person’s character to see how they handle defeat. In the Christian bible, Jesus is a more compelling character than Yahweh. Jesus faces adversity, which sometimes he accepts calmly –…
